A liquid radioactive waste neutralization method

Methods typically used for liquid radioactive waste neutralization include ultra-filtration of the treated solution and radioactive processing of the obtained concentrate by means of a gamma radiation source. In the new technology, a hydrogen peroxide in the amount enough to establish the ratio of surface-active substance (SAS) to H2O2 as 1 : (0.3-0.4) is to be introduced in the solution before the radioactive processing. In the radioactive processing, hydrogen peroxide in 2-3 equal parts in each 100 kGr is additionally introduced in the solution to ensure the final ratio SAS:H2O2=1:1.2. After completion of the radioactive processing, the concentrate obtained is boiled down to produce a cubic residue, which is then directed for further solidification, and a condensate, which is then mixed with a cleaned ultra-filtered washing solution suitable for re-use.

The second modification relates to a process when a solution containing a cesium radionuclide is treated. In this case, nickel or copper ferrocyanide is preliminary added in the solution before ultra-filtration.

Slyunchev O.M, etc.

 


Patent number: 2160474
Publishing date: January 23, 2001
